Young Rembrandts drawing classes are
offered on Thursdays from 2:40 pm to 3:40 pm at St. Andrew the Apostle School during the
school year for children from Kindergarten through 5th grade. Our philosophy is "Drawing is a learnable art".
Children learn how to draw a new project each week. Subject
matter varies from abstracts to still lives and cartooning to art
history. We focus on fine motor skills, spatial and global
reasoning (math skills), attention to detail and focus. We also
provide children with self-confidence, self-esteem and
self-expression in their work. Techniques and lessons spill over
into aspects of your child's homework. Classes are held immediately
after school for one hour. Students complete a project each week
that will be displayed in an "Art Gallery" in our school for that
